This 7-day Mount Kenya trekking adventure ascends through the spectacular Chogoria Route and descends via the scenic Sirimon Route on Mount Kenya. Designed for gradual acclimatization and immersive mountain exploration, this route offers trekkers the opportunity to experience Mount Kenya’s most dramatic landscapes including alpine lakes, valleys, tarns, moorlands, and towering peaks.

The trek passes through dense rainforest, giant heather zones, the stunning Gorges Valley, Lake Michaelson, Simba Tarn, and Shipton’s Camp before reaching Point Lenana (4,985m) for a breathtaking sunrise summit experience. This itinerary is ideal for travelers seeking a slower-paced trek with excellent acclimatization and scenic diversity.

Day 1

Nairobi – Chogoria Bandas (2,950m)

After pickup in Nairobi, drive toward Chogoria Town before continuing to the park gate for registration formalities.

From here, continue through the dense rainforest zone before being dropped off for the start of your trek.

The hike covers approximately 5–10 km through beautiful forest scenery leading to Chogoria Bandas campsite.

Enjoy dinner and overnight surrounded by Mount Kenya’s peaceful wilderness.

Day 2

Chogoria Bandas – Lake Ellis (3,455m)

After breakfast at approximately 8:00 AM, begin trekking toward Lake Ellis while passing the beautiful Nithi Falls.

The trail gradually ascends through giant heather vegetation and alpine moorlands with spectacular mountain scenery.

The trek takes approximately 6–7 hours before arriving at Lake Ellis campsite, a peaceful alpine location ideal for acclimatization and relaxation.

Day 3

Lake Ellis – Lake Michaelson (4,000m)

Breakfast is served at 7:00 AM before beginning a longer and more demanding trek toward Lake Michaelson.

The route covers approximately 10 km with an altitude gain of around 650m, reaching a high point of approximately 4,200m before descending into the spectacular Gorges Valley.

Arrive at Lake Michaelson campsite surrounded by dramatic mountain scenery and enjoy dinner and overnight stay in this remote alpine environment.

Day 4

Lake Michaelson – Simba Tarn (4,600m)

Breakfast is served at 8:00 AM before departing for Simba Tarn.

This shorter trekking day serves mainly as an acclimatization day to help prepare for the summit attempt.

The trek covers approximately 5 km and takes around 4–5 hours.

Upon arrival at camp, lunch is served followed by optional short walks or time to relax while enjoying the surrounding mountain scenery.

Day 5

Simba Tarn – Point Lenana Summit (4,985m) – Shipton’s Camp (4,200m)

Wake up at approximately 4:30 AM for the summit attempt.

After a light snack and hot drink, begin the steep scree ascent at 5:00 AM toward Point Lenana, covering approximately 2 km in around 2 hours.

Reach the summit at sunrise and enjoy breathtaking panoramic views across the surrounding landscapes.

After celebrating your summit achievement, descend to Shipton’s Camp for breakfast and spend the rest of the day relaxing beneath Mount Kenya’s main peaks — Batian and Nelion.

Optional short walks around camp are available.

Day 6

Shipton’s Camp – Old Moses Camp (3,300m)

After breakfast, descend leisurely through the scenic Mackinder’s Valley toward Old Moses Camp.

The trail passes through beautiful moorland vegetation and offers excellent views of Mount Kenya’s alpine terrain.

Arrive at Old Moses Camp in the afternoon for dinner and overnight stay.

Day 7

Old Moses Camp – Sirimon Gate (2,650m) – Nairobi

After breakfast, begin the final descent toward Sirimon Gate.

This relatively short trek covers approximately 9 km and takes about 2 hours through scenic mountain vegetation and forest landscapes.

Upon arrival at the gate, celebrate the successful completion of your Mount Kenya trekking adventure before transferring back to Nairobi.
